Orange Lake
Orange Lake is a lake in Becker, Minnesota. Orange Lake is situated nearby to the hamlet LaBelle, as well as near the village Lake Park.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Lake Park and Audubon.

Lake Park is a city in Becker County, Minnesota, United States. The population was 728 at the 2020 census. Lake Park is situated 4 miles north of Orange Lake.

Audubon is a city in Becker County, Minnesota, United States. The population was 560 at the 2020 census. Audubon is situated 4½ miles northeast of Orange Lake.
